After collecting the class 12 admit card 2026 RBSE admit card 2026, students must keep it safe until the exams are over. However, a few students may lose it by mistake. In such cases, the students must contact their school authority. The school authority will then re-download their admit card and get it signed and stamped by the school head. Then, the students can re-collect their admit cards. However, to avoid such a situation, the students are suggested to keep a copy or two of their admit cards.

After collecting the RBSE 12th Pravesh Patra 2026, the students must check the details mentioned on it. RBSE hall ticket 2026 class 12 includes important details related to the exam and the personal academic details of students.
These details include the board name, exam name, student's name, roll number, exam center, exam dates and days, exam timings, subject names, subject codes, etc. Moreover, the admit card also mentioned the exam day guidelines.

Students must note that the online released RBSE result mark sheet class 12 is provisional in nature. The original marksheet of the RBSE 12th result is released by the board in offline mode. The board sends the original marksheet of RBSE Inter results directly to all the registered schools. Once the original marksheet is released, students need to collect the hard copy of their RBSE Class 12 result marksheet from their respective schools. Until the original marksheet is released by the board, students should download and take a printout of the online released result scorecard for temporary use.

After the declaration of RBSE class 12 result, many students find themselves not satisfied with the result. If you are one of them, you can simply apply for the scrutiny process. After declaration of result, RBSE announces the date to apply for the scrutiny process. You can apply for scrutiny online on the official website of the board. While applying for scrutiny, you need to pay scrutiny fees. Thereafter, your answer sheet will be re-checked. The board will then release the final result of your performance in the exam.

To pass the RBSE 12th exams, the students need to secure the minimum marks as prescribed by the board. As per the Rajasthan Board, the students need to secure at least 33 percent marks in each subject to clear the RBSE 12th exams. The students must note that the final marks of the exam will be calculated including the marks in Practical exams. The board conducts each paper of RBSE class 12 exams for 100 marks. Theoretical exams are held for a total of 80 marks (70 marks in a few subjects such as Physics, Chemistry, Biology, Psychology etc.) while Internal assessment exams are held for a total of 20 marks.
